Abstract

The cell selection mechanism that provides services to each mobile station is referred to as cell selection. For maximizing the current and future of cellular networks, it is necessary to optimize the process. The OFDMA-based systems are LTE-Advanced and IEEE 802.16m for satisfying the mobile station minimum demand by having one or more base station simultaneously. The problem is considered as the optimization problem and defines the problem as it is not considered as NP-hard and also not possible for approximation with a reasonable factor. The assumption is that the maximum required bandwidth of a single mobile station is defined as the r-fraction of the capacity of the base station. For cell selection, this paper consists of two algorithms. The first algorithm defines the creation of a (1-r) approximate solution, this is applicable when the coverage of the mobile station is done by one or more base station simultaneously. The second algorithm defines the creation of an approximate solution (1-r /2-r) when the coverage of each mobile station is covered by a maximum one base station. A simulation research that describes the benefit of using our algorithms that have limited and high-loaded power for the future of 4G networks completes the overall study. The performance and capacity are better than the existing algorithms.
